Goldfish the size of dinner plates are multiplying at an alarming rate in the sewers after thoughtless owners flush them down the toilet.

The creatures not only survive their journey into the sewers, but thrive - and Canadian authorities have issued a warning after 40 were found in one sewage plant.

Kate Wilson from Alberta’s environment department said, 'That's really scary because it means they're reproducing in the wild, they are getting quite large and they are surviving the winters.

‘It's quite a surprise how large we're finding them and the sheer number.'

Goldfish are considered an invasive species, and carry parasites which could be harmful to other fish.
